Five Reasons To Invest In Gutter Cleaning
Maintain Gutters’ Functionality: Over time, gutters can become clogged with leaves, twigs, and other debris, hindering their ability to effectively channel rainwater. This can lead to overflowing gutters, which can damage the roof, fascia, and soffits. By investing in cleaning, you keep your gutters functioning as intended, allowing them to efficiently carry rainwater away from your home.
Prevent Pest Infestations: Clogged gutters can become a breeding ground for pests, such as mosquitoes, ants, and even rodents. The stagnant water and decaying debris in the gutters attract these unwanted visitors. Gutter Maintenance Tips
To ensure your gutters function properly, follow these maintenance tips. First, make it a habit to clean your gutters regularly, removing any accumulated debris to prevent clogs and overflow. Consider using a gutter cleaner in Epping or roof cleaning solution to effectively break down stubborn debris within the rainwater system. Additionally, inspect your gutters for signs of rust, corrosion, or warping. If you notice any of these issues, promptly arrange for repairs or replacement.
Trimming back any overhanging trees or shrubs near your roof and gutters is another important step. This helps minimize the entry of leaves and twigs into your gutters, reducing the risk of clogging.

What tools are necessary for gutter cleaning?
To clean your gutters, you will need a ladder and a gutter cleaner. A gutter cleaner is a pole with a brush attachment that extends to reach difficult areas. You may also consider using gloves, goggles, and a dust mask for additional protection.
What does gutter cleaning involve?
Gutter cleaning involves removing debris, leaves, and other matter from the gutters on the roof. It is important to keep them clean to prevent blockages and water damage. Regular gutter cleaning ensures that your roof and home are protected, and water can flow freely.
How frequently should I clean my gutters?
It is recommended to clean your gutters at least twice a year, typically in the spring and fall. However, the frequency may vary depending on your location and the amount of debris accumulation. It may be necessary to clean more frequently in some cases.
